Wisconsin Dairy Queen and her Court
Group portrait of Rose Rosandlich, from Granton, who was elected Dairy Queen in 1935, and her court. They are, from left to right: Harry [?], Bernice Wegner, Henry Dries, Rose Rosandlich, Mr. John Semrod, Mrs. Semrod, and Paul Weiss. Taken outside the Wisconsin State Capitol, which the Queen visited on August 27. The Dairy Queen competition was connected to the Wisconsin State Fair and was sponsored by the Wisconsin Co-op Milk Pool. |
